This is a list of countries by natural gas imports. For informational purposes, several non-sovereign entities are also included in this list. Many countries are both importers and exporters of natural gas. For instance, although Canada appears on the list below as the world's 32nd largest gas importer, it exports more natural gas than it imports, and so is a net exporter of natural gas.
